A flash of yellow among the green—if you"ve spotted it, you"ve probably seen a yellow warbler. These tiny songbirds, like many others, bring a pop of colour to the Canadian landscape every spring, sticking around through summer. Hopping from branch to branch, they spend their day feasting on insects like caterpillars and beetles.
